Tomberlin’s Take: Why Not Birmingham For Amazon’s Second Headquarters?
By Michael Tomberlin
When Amazon announced publicly that it is seeking a city for a second U.S. headquarters, it sparked dreams in metros from coast to coast.Landing what is dubbed “HQ2” with its $5 billion in investment and 50,000 jobs is just a dream for most. Even the “experts” (anyone with a Facebook account) came out to shoot down how ludicrous it is to even think a city like Birmingham could compete against the likes of an Atlanta, a Chicago or any number of cities.
